Fellowship Nominations
Fellowship of the College is awarded as a mark of
distinction and recognition of contributions to psychiatry.
Because it is a College award, candidates and citators are asked
to demonstrate and evidence significant contributions to the core
purposes of the Royal College of Psychiatrists:
- Setting standards and promoting excellence in mental
health care
- Leading, representing and supporting
psychiatrists
- Working with service users, carers and their
organisations
Candidates are invited also to document their contributions to
the College's stated aim of patient centred practice through:
- Professionalism
- innovation and research
- lifelong learning
- fairness and inclusion
- ethical practice
- multi-disciplinary working
If successful, Fellows are entitled to use the designation
‘FRCPsych’ once they have paid the prescribed registration fee.
Nominees for the Fellowship must be subscribing Members of the
College at the time when nominations are submitted. Sponsors will
be notified if this is not the case.
Nominations are considered annually by the Fellowship
Sub-Committee, a sub-committee of the Education, Training &
Standards Committee.

Sponsors
Nominations for the College Fellowship must be supported by
two Sponsors, both of whom must be subscribing Members of the
College.
Sponsors must not be members of the Education,
Training & Standards Committee at the time of submitting their
nomination.
